The Calico Cafe Bar is a new addition to the Stanneylands Hotel, and their all-new afternoon tea menu aims to create the perfect alternative for ladies who lunch.

Served in the conservatory of a traditional country house, Calico's Afternoon Tea (£13.50) is available between 3pm-5.30pm, and offers a range of finger sandwiches, scones and homemade cakes.
For the truly indulgent, the Calico Champagne Afternoon Tea (£22.50) includes a glass of Rose Champagne or the Cheshire Cat Cocktail, while the Calico High Tea (£29.50) offers a choice of eggs benedict, smoked salmon and scrambled eggs or a parma ham croque monsieur.
